Directions:
Organize Your Items: Start by collecting a variety of cardboard rolls you have lying around. Gather them in different sizes and shapes to work with.
Cut and Shape: Depending on the project, you might need to cut the cardboard rolls into smaller sections. Scissors are perfect for making precise cuts. For crafts like flower arrangements or wall hangings, you can cut the rolls into rings of different sizes.
Glue and Assemble: For projects that require more complex construction (like storage holders or intricate decorations), use glue to bond the pieces together. Apply pressure for a few minutes to ensure the glue sets.
Decorate: Transform the rolls into something visually appealing by adding paint, stickers, fabric, or even wrapping paper. Whether you’re creating a simple pencil holder or a more elaborate DIY flower pot, decoration will give your project a polished finish.
Final Touches: For extra flair, you can attach ribbons or beads to complete your creation. If your cardboard roll project is for organization, label it for even greater functionality.

Variations:
Organizational Solutions: Cardboard rolls can be used to create drawer dividers, cable organizers, or even a unique jewelry holder.
Decorative Crafts: With a little paint and creativity, cardboard rolls can become anything from elegant wall art to homemade gift boxes.
Gardening Projects: Use the rolls as biodegradable seed starters. Fill them with soil and plant seeds for an eco-friendly gardening approach.
FAQ:
Can I use any type of cardboard roll? Yes, any cardboard roll can be repurposed, but make sure it’s clean and dry before using it in your projects.
How durable are these projects? Cardboard roll projects can vary in durability depending on how you assemble and decorate them. If you need added strength, consider reinforcing them with extra layers of paper or a coat of sealant.
How do I store my cardboard rolls before using them? Store them in a cool, dry place away from moisture to prevent any damage. You can also store them upright like books for easy access.
Are these projects child-friendly? Many of these projects are simple enough for children to help with, especially when it comes to crafting and decorating. Always supervise when using scissors or glue.
How can I make my cardboard roll projects more eco-friendly? Reuse old materials like scrap paper, natural twine, or fabric scraps to decorate, and choose non-toxic paints and glues for a more sustainable approach.
